在数字化时代,人工智能(AI)技术已经深入到我们生活的方方面面。其中,AI声音技术作为人机交互的重要手段,正逐渐改变着我们的沟通方式。阿里云作为国内领先的云服务提供商,其AI声音训练技术更是备受瞩目。那么,阿里云是如何让机器语音更自然、更懂你的呢?本文将带你揭秘这一技术背后的奥秘。
一、声音数据采集与处理
阿里云AI声音训练的第一步是采集和整理大量的声音数据。这些数据来源于真实用户,涵盖了各种口音、语速、语调等,确保了模型的多样性和准确性。
1. 数据采集
数据采集主要通过以下几种方式:
- 麦克风录音:通过麦克风采集用户的语音数据,包括日常对话、朗读、唱歌等。
- 公开数据集:从公开数据集中获取高质量的声音数据,如TIMIT、LibriSpeech等。
2. 数据处理
在采集到声音数据后,需要进行一系列的处理,包括:
- 降噪:去除背景噪声,提高语音质量。
- 归一化:将不同音量的声音调整到同一水平,便于后续处理。
- 分割:将长语音分割成短语音片段,便于模型训练。
二、深度学习模型
阿里云AI声音训练的核心是深度学习模型。通过训练,模型可以学会识别、合成和生成语音。
1. 语音识别
语音识别是将语音信号转换为文字的过程。阿里云使用的深度学习模型包括:
- 卷积神经网络(CNN):用于提取语音特征。
- 循环神经网络(RNN):用于处理序列数据,如语音信号。
2. 语音合成
语音合成是将文字转换为语音的过程。阿里云使用的深度学习模型包括:
- 深度神经网络(DNN):用于将文字转换为语音特征。
- 生成对抗网络(GAN):用于生成高质量的语音。
3. 语音生成
语音生成是利用深度学习模型生成全新的语音,包括:
- 变分自编码器(VAE):用于生成具有多样性的语音。
- 长短期记忆网络(LSTM):用于生成流畅的语音。
三、自然语言处理
为了让机器语音更懂你,阿里云还结合了自然语言处理(NLP)技术。通过分析用户的输入,模型可以更好地理解用户意图,从而生成更准确的语音。
1. 语义理解
语义理解是NLP技术的重要组成部分。通过分析用户的输入,模型可以理解用户的需求,如查询天气、设置闹钟等。
2. 情感分析
情感分析可以识别用户的情绪,如喜悦、愤怒、悲伤等。阿里云的AI声音训练技术可以将用户的情绪融入语音合成过程中,使机器语音更具情感色彩。
四、实际应用
阿里云AI声音训练技术在多个领域得到了广泛应用,如:
- 智能客服:通过语音识别和合成,实现7*24小时的人工智能客服。
- 智能家居:通过语音控制智能家居设备,如电视、空调、音响等。
- 教育领域:通过语音合成技术,实现智能语音教学。
五、总结
阿里云AI声音训练技术通过采集和处理大量声音数据、运用深度学习模型和自然语言处理技术,实现了让机器语音更自然、更懂你。随着技术的不断发展,我们有理由相信,AI声音技术将在未来的人机交互中发挥越来越重要的作用。
